

Wayne was born on September 13, 1939, in Red Oak, Iowa, to Goldie and Merle Templeton. When Wayne was young, his family moved to a farm in LaMonte, Missouri, where he spent much of his youth and graduated from LaMonte High School in 1957. Shortly after graduation, Wayne proudly enlisted in the United States Army, serving his country from August 30, 1957, to August 29, 1960.
Wayne married Virginia Kindle, and together they welcomed three children, Curby, Lee Ann and Charlie. He pursued higher education at State Fair College and Iowa State University, building a strong foundation for his future career.
Later in life, Wayne met the love of his life, Virginia “Ginny” Hughes. They were married on October 14, 1980, beginning a loving partnership that lasted 45 years. Through this marriage, Wayne became a devoted stepfather to two additional sons, Brian and Brad Swearngin. Wayne worked for 35 years as a gas controller for Panhandle Eastern Pipeline and later continued his career with Coastal Marketing Company/Duke Energy. After retiring, Wayne and Ginny enjoyed working part-time as school bus drivers for about three years.
Wayne’s greatest joy was his family. He deeply loved traveling to visit his children, siblings, and extended family and treasured time spent together. Most recently, he made a special trip from Texas to Missouri to attend his grandson’s wedding and see family. Wayne also enjoyed doing puzzles and had a lifelong love of travel. He was fortunate to see much of the world, visiting Europe, Asia, and Africa, among many other destinations, and enjoyed numerous cruises along the way. Wayne gave back to his community in many ways, he volunteered for AARP, at the local Katy Senior Center. At any given time, you could find him helping to do handy man jobs in the homes of the elderly through the Katy Home Savers. A few years ago, he and Ginny were recipients of the Volunteer of the Year award from the Happy Hearts Group.
